Butter/London believes in rock ‘n’ roll, Great Britain, fashion and “colour not carcinogens”.
The forward-thinking company, whose range
of nail lacquers and treatments are now available in Australia, is a
self-proclaimed 3 Free company. Meaning, they proudly manufacture
non-toxic products free of chemicals -
Formaldehyde, Toluene and DBP (Dibutyl Phthalate) to be precise -
linked to cancer, birth defects, neurological damage, and other illnesses with alarming consequences.
By omitting the chemicals allegedly used by other, more established brands, it’s only
natural one might assume butter/LONDON in turn sacrificed effective
formulas and exciting colour palettes as well.
